Skålvisered
Skålvisered is a hamlet in Gothenburg Municipality, Västra Götaland County. Skålvisered is situated nearby to the hamlet Gullö, as well as near Näset.Places of Interest

Mysterna is a locality situated in Gothenburg Municipality, Västra Götaland County, Sweden. It had 3,418 inhabitants in 2010. Mysterna is situated 5 km southeast of Skålvisered.

Rödbo is a locality situated in Gothenburg Municipality, Västra Götaland County, Sweden. It had 278 inhabitants in 2010. Rödbo is situated 5 km northeast of Skålvisered.
Kungälv
Photo: Fingalo,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Kungälv is a city and the seat of Kungälv Municipality in Västra Götaland County, Sweden. It is also a part of Greater Gothenburg Metropolitan Area. It had 22,768 inhabitants in 2010.
